Use π only when you need to communicate a specific time of 9 o'clock in scheduling, reminders, or calendar-related messages. Use π whenever you want to convey nighttime vibes, say good night, set a romantic or dreamy mood, or add aesthetic flair to evening-related content. In dating or social contexts, π is almost always the better choice unless you're literally confirming a 9 PM meetup.
